Bunny ladies back in London
Playboy Casino returns

Back in the sixties, The Playboy Casino venues at Manchester and Portsmouth had big roles in London’s casinos. Today, the company has decided to strike back in the capital city, with the appearance of two new buildings.

As we all know, Playboy Entertainment began with the famous magazine, which is still in the market nowadays and has a large share of the market. It became a worldwide brand, and its bunny logo is everywhere to be found on anything, from underwear to coffee mugs. An important icon that still functions nowadays is the Playboy Mansion, where creator Hugh Heffner lives with his group of girls.

The enterprise plans on opening two casinos in London by 2010. Both of them will offer games of roulette and blackjack, as well as waitresses in sexy Playboy bunny outfits. Apart from this, high class restaurants and burger bars will be available, as well as various top dj’s who will be spinning the decks on special occasions.

When it used to work, back in the sixties and seventies, the Playboy casino was a blooming casino which had high-rolling players as customers, until it was suddenly closed down by a police raid in 1981. The casino wasn’t able to recover from this, even though no charges were brought up. Frequent clients included Michael Caine, Seanne Connery and George Best, a football player who coincidentally married a previous Playboy bunny.
